2007 Devil Picks: Guide for ASU students (Bars and Clubs)

BEST PLACE TO BE SEEN
Casey Moore’s Oyster House
850 S. Ash Ave., Tempe, (480) 968-9935

Casey Moore’s is the “Cheers” of Tempe — there’s always someone to talk to at this Irish bar, known for the best patio drinking in the Valley.

BEST BAR FOR HANGING OUT
Rula Bula
401 S. Mill Ave., Tempe, (480) 929-9500
rulabula.com

Just north of the crowded Tempe dance bars, you can find this relaxed Irish pub. Offering indoor seating and an outdoor patio, Rula Bula is the chill place to hang out and enjoy a low-key evening.

BEST BAR FOR HOOKING UP
Cherry Pit & Lounge
411 S. Mill Ave., Tempe, (480) 966-3573
cherryloungeaz.com

Feel free to go wild at Mill Avenue's Cherry Pit & Lounge. (Get Out file photo)
With two dimly-lit rooms and a dance floor made for bumpin’ and grindin’, Tempe dance club Cherry Pit & Lounge is the perfect place to meet your Mr. or Ms. Right Now and exchange a couple numbers by last call. Young and beautiful students flock to the illuminated red club every week to mingle with other single coeds.

BEST CAMPUS BAR
The Vine Tavern & Eatery
801 E. Apache Blvd., Tempe, (480) 894-2662

Drink, sing, drink more, eat, drink even more. At the Vine in Tempe, you can do all these things and more. Actually, that’s about it, but the karaoke is fun and the beer is cheap.

BEST DIVE BAR
The Rogue Bar
423 N. Scottsdale Road, Scottsdale, (480) 947-3580
roguebar.com

A true punk-rock bar that has embraced indie rock with its dance night Shake!, while continuing to embrace its dirty punk-rock roots.

BAR WHERE THE COVER IS WORTH IT
e4
4282 N. Drinkwater Blvd., Scottsdale, (480) 970-3325
e4-az.com

With rooms named after the elements — earth, air, fire, water — the swanky club and lounge offers something for everyone. The see-and-be-seen spot is the first club in downtown Scottsdale to give Myst and Axis/Radius some competition.

GLAM hosts the best hipster dance events including Faux Show. (photo by Ashley Harris, Special to Get Out)
BEST HIPSTER DANCE
GLAM
3174 E. Indian School Road, Phoenix, (602) 955-5689

One of the best places to be seen (and be scene), GLAM offers indie-rock dance nights, as well as vinyl-heavy rotations during Faux Show and Boombox Crew.

BEST PLACE TO SPOT A CELEB
Axis/Radius
7340 E. Indian Plaza, Scottsdale, (480) 970-1112
axis-radius.com

Celebrities, local and from Hollywood, are known to hit this Scottsdale nightclub. This summer it held a celebrity night, Axis Hollywood, where celebs such as Nick Lachey and Tyrese hosted.

Four Peaks Brewery in Tempe is always our favorite microbrewery. (Get Out file photo)
BEST MICROBREWERY
Four Peaks Brewery
1340 E. Eighth St., Tempe, (480) 303-9967
fourpeaks.com

Support local beer by quaffing the tasty brews (including Hefeweizen, 8th Street Ale and an oatmeal stout) made fresh in Tempe. The food’s not bad, either.

BEST MARGARITA
Salty Señorita
3636 N. Scottsdale Road, Scottsdale, (480) 946-7258
saltysenorita.com

Big, salty, delicious. The bartenders at the Salty Señorita know how to make a mean margarita. Keep ’em coming.

BEST BAR FOR BODY SHOTS
Dos Gringos Trailer Park
1001 E. Eighth St., Tempe, (480) 968-7879
dosgringosaz.com

Packed with sweaty ASU students in their skimpiest club get-ups, Dos Gringos is the place (within stumbling distance of the dorms) to find that sexy boy or girl to let you lick salt off them.

BEST GAY BAR
BS West
7125 E. Fifth Ave., Scottsdale, (480) 945-9028
bswest.com

Honestly, there’s a real lack of gay bars in the East Valley (most of the happening ones are in Phoenix), but there’s always this joint, located smack dab in downtown Scottsdale’s drinking (and arts) district.
